FAMILIES across the region are being urged to look out for the elderly and plan sensibly over the Christmas and New Year period.

As with previous years, many pharmacies and GP practices have specific opening and closing times over the next couple of weeks.

The local NHS is therefore asking people to check details and prepare for the holiday period by checking opening times and ensuring they have enough medication to see the period through.

Dr Charles Parker, local GP and Clinical Chair of NHS Hambleton, Richmondshire and Whitby Clinical Commissioning Group said: “Looking out for an elderly relative, friend or neighbour is also important this time of year. “Check if they have enough food and drink over the festive period as well as popping in to check they’re not lonely.”
